7 Appendix
7.1
Description of On-board Devices
This chapter describes how the on-board devices are accessed by
operating system drivers. When an operating system, such as OS-9
and VxWorks, is used, there should be no need to address these
devices with user-written code.
7.1.1 SMI Ticker
The output of counter/timer 2 of the W83C553F may be routed to the
System Management Interrupt input of the CPU when J1701 is set to
position 7-8. This can be used to generate a periodic interrupt with
higher priority than normal interrupts. A negative edge of the PC-
Speaker output triggers the SMI when enabled via bit 7 of I/O
address $809.
Writing to I/O address $808 clears the SMI.
